Hi everyone
Over the last 12 years it has been my privilege to represent you on the Porirua City Council or Greater Wellington the Regional Council. I have enjoyed the work very much.
Once I stood for the mayoralty and came second to John Burke. Now I am standing again because there is a job to be done. I seek a chance to address long standing issues within the Council. Issues such as undisciplined spending , the ever increasing rates burden, and the need for a realistic vision. We need to sort out our budget and sort out our values. Then we will be able to proceed together.
I have set out my policy as an overview, but perhaps more important I have set out the big goals (vision) that I have.
Finally, the councillors need to lighten up. We need a sense of humour around the council table, greater tolerance of others, and to take ourselves less seriously. Better decisions would come from a more relaxed approach.
